‘Ram Setu’ box office collection first weekend: Akshay Kumar starrer beats ‘Thank God’, crosses Rs 55 crore nett – Times of India


Akshay Kumar starrer ‘Ram Setu’ has crossed the 50 crore mark at the end of its first extended weekend. The movie released on the occasion of Diwali and clashed with Ajay Devgan and Sidharth Malhotra started ‘Thank God’.

Due to India’s match at the ongoing T20 World Cup, few people turned up to watch ‘Ram Setu’ in theatres. On Sunday, the film earned Rs 7.75 crore nett. At the end of its six-day extended weekend, ‘Ram Setu’ has raked in Rs 55 crore nett, reports boxofficeindia. ‘Ram Setu’ has recorded a positive trend in Gujarat / Saurashtra circuits, which contributed Rs 11 crore nett to the film’s total, while Rajasthan added Rs 4.20 crore nett and CI earned Rs 2.65 crore nett. Its competitor ‘Thank God’ has earned only Rs 26 crore at the end of its first extended weekend.

Directed by Abhishek Sharma, ‘Ram Setu’ is an action adventure drama which features Akshay Kumar, Nushrratt Bharuccha, Jacqueline Fernandez and Satya Dev in pivotal roles. Speaking about the film, director Abhishek Sharma had said, “During the pandemic in 2020, a thought came to me and I began to work on it. I called up Akshay Kumar and he asked me if I had written a screenplay. I wrote it and sent it to him. Akshay sir and Vikram sir (Vikram Sharma of Abundantia Entertainment) jammed on it. We all liked the idea and decided to take this journey together. I thank them for supporting my vision.”
